Ticket: Crashfall ingest failing on staging

New folks, please read carefully. The Pebblekit mobile app's crash reports aren't reaching the symbolication queue because staging's env file was copied without its upload credential. Symptoms: 401s in the collector logs every five minutes. To fix, add the missing line to the env file, exactly as follows.

secret setting of fafop-tagep: VAULT_KEY29=6a815d21e2d77cc25ef1802d73ee6

# Heads up, support folks: this fixture simulates the slow humidity
# sensor drift we keep seeing on GreenLoft's Sprouterra controllers.
# The drift ramps at about 0.3% per simulated hour, which is enough
# to trip the recalibration alarm by tick 40. If a customer reports
# phantom misting cycles, run this fixture first before escalating
# to the firmware crew. The replay endpoint needs auth, so when you
# call it, use the bearer token below.

session JWT of yawep-yawep = eyJhbGciOiJIUzI1NiIsInR5cCI6IkpXVCJ9.eyJzdWIiOiI3pWF3_In0.aXYsHiog

Re: fanout worker changes in Pulsewire. The queue drain loop still blocks when downstream push endpoints slow down. That's why support keeps seeing "notification delayed" tickets during Brightvale campaign sends. The fix caps in-flight batches per shard and sheds load past the high-water mark instead of buffering forever. If a customer reports stalls, check shard lag first; don't bump worker counts, that just moves the backlog. Defaults below are safe for prod; only change them with an on-call sign-off. Current tuning constants are:

limits module of tafof-kagef:
RATE_LIMITS = {
    "zorix": 10,
    "ralath": 1,
    "quenwyn": 2,
    "holael": 10,
}

Migration step 4: PortionForge recipe-scaling calculator moves off the legacy Grainhouse cluster this week. Cut over reads first, then writes; the scaler cache must be warmed before traffic shifts or unit conversions will fall back to imperial defaults. Rollback window is 48 hours. Owner: Tilda on the Measures team. Before flipping the router, apply the new config exactly as shown below.

service settings:
PRAIX_LOG_LEVEL=error
PRAIX_METRICS_HOST=metrics.praix.qorvelcorp.corp
PRAIX_POOL_SIZE=16